Solution Overview
Problem
Existing web advertising methods, such as pop-up and banner advertisements, are often ignored by users due to their lack of targeting, leading to a need for a system that can insert targeted content into portlet content streams based on a user's desired display mode to capture their attention effectively.
Innovation Solution
A portal program with a container-managed portlet filter that inserts targeted web content into a portlet content stream based on the user's chosen display mode, ensuring that the content is displayed when the user's attention is focused, such as during edit mode for a specific portlet.

A system, method and program product for inserting targeted content into a portlet content stream is provided. Specifically, the present invention provides a portal program that includes a container-managed portlet filter for inserting targeted web content into a portlet content stream based on a desired display mode of the portal user. Under the present invention, web content is obtained by a portlet from a content provider. Once obtained, the portlet outputs the web content as a portlet content stream to the portlet filter. The portlet filter then inserts the targeted content based on the desired display mode of the user. The combined targeted content and portlet content stream is then outputted to an aggregator where it is organized for display as a portal page.
